Reading through this I might have got the wrong idea, but:

If he is eating NatureDiet which is complete, plus having a mixer which is a bulker, as someone said he is getting a lot of grain which could be making him windy.

If he wont eat the wet without the dry and visa versa, have you thought about adding a complete biscuit to balance out the grain content. Such as adding wainrights salmon/potato dry food to some nature diet?

Otherwise have you tried him on something simple like chicken and rice and then gradually introducing pre-made food back in.

Also try to feed meats better on sensitive tummys, like white meats and chicken. Lamb and beef can cause upset tumys in sensitive dogs.
